Most container glass plants have world-class equipment and 1990s management systems. We audit the management layer — what each leader actually does each day, who owns which KPI, how decisions get made, and where the system breaks down at shift handover.

Leader Standard Work, by role
Shift leader, supervisor, hot-end superintendent, plant manager, VP Operations — what each does each day, codified.
Decision rights, made explicit
Who can stop a line, who owns which KPI, who escalates what — written down and agreed.
Cadence that holds under pressure
Tier 1/2/3 meeting structure, gemba walks and KPI reviews — designed to survive a bad shift, not just a good day.

How it runs.
Time-use audit
We sit with each leader for two days; we measure where the day actually goes.
Cadence + ownership map
Current state mapped, gaps identified, future state designed with leadership.
Pilot
Install on one shift or one line, coach daily, tune the cadence.
Plant rollout
Roll out across the plant with internal champions; we coach the coaches.
